OSCR note: This SCIO has been set up to replace Cambuslang & Rutherglen Christian Reachout Charitable Trust SC022459. Cambuslang & Rutherglen Christian Reachout Charitable Trust SC022459 has now wound up and transferred the assets and liabilities to Cambuslang and Rutherglan Christian Reachout Trust SCIO SC048919

02 Purpose and work

What the charity exists to do

We are set up to engage and support young people, to increase their understanding of the Christian faith, and to put their faith into action. Towards these ends we deliver a five projects in all the local primary schools in Cambuslang and Rutherglen throughout the school year - about Christmas and Easter and dealing with resilience, buddying and the transition from primary to secondary school. We support bible based groups in all the primary and secondary schools as well as being part of chaplaincy teams delivering assemblies. We also participate in running three residential weekends for the churches and schools in the area and a residential holiday in conjunction with SU Scotland. We also support the churches in the area with their youth and children's work.
